A film festival that rewinds time and lets you experience films as what they once used to be: delicate projects, executed through meticulous planning.
Today, we zoom past Instagram filters, automated editing apps on our phones and countless banal videos on our timeline. Harkat wants to travel back to a time of Celluloid. It seems almost utopian now, where film making was slow, meticulous and reserved for a select few, patient enough to spend hours and hours on formulating a piece of art which could only be admired in a cinema hall but we believe it is doable. To relive the magic of the churning of a film through a projector onto a skeckless cloth. There is something tangible about that as a medium.
Bringing together the passion for film making, it being a community arts space and a penchant for curated experiences, Harkat Studios is proud to bring the first 16mm film festival of the 21 st century to Mumbai. It seems anachronistic, but possibly this is exactly what we need: A slow film festival.
Taking place fittingly on the 16th of November, its programme lasts from morning to late night, packed with workshops, screenings and talks.

60 on 16 films - Call for Entries
Harkat Studios is inviting young filmmakers to send in their idea in no more than a paragraph, along with a treatment note and their profile. The selected ones get an Arri SR2 16mm film camera for a couple of hours, technical support, 40 feet of film (Approx 1 minute) and Harkat Studios will develop their film. The films made will be screened at the Harkat 16mm film festival on Dec 16. Only 5 spots are available. Send in your ideas to us@harkat.in.
